区块链技术是一种去中心化的数字账本技术,它通过将数据打包成区块,然后将这些区块按时间顺序链接在一起,形成一条链,来实现数据的安全、高效传输与存储。这项技术最初是为比特币而设计的,但随着技术的发展,已经扩展到各个领域,包括金融、物流、医疗、版权保护等。
理解区块链的工作原理,需要从几个核心概念入手:分布式、去中心化、加密技术、共识机制以及智能合约等。每一个概念都是区块链高效运行的基石,以下将细致解析这些技术原理,并探讨它们如何协同工作,从而实现数据的透明性、安全性与不可篡改性。
区块链的基础架构采用了分布式网络,参与者(节点)可以在全球范围内任意分布。每一个节点都保存着区块链的完整副本,数据不再集中存储在单一服务器上,这样就避免了单点故障的风险。当参与者有新的交易请求时,网络上的每一个节点都会接收到这个请求,进行验证并将其打包成新区块。
这种机制的优点在于数据的透明性,每个节点可以随时查看区块链上的所有数据,包括历史交易记录和当前账户的状态。此外,由于每个节点都持有完整的区块链副本,即使个别节点发生故障,区块链仍然可以继续运作。因此,这种架构极大地提高了区块链系统的可靠性。
去中心化是区块链技术的核心特征之一。传统的系统往往依赖于中心化的管理机构,例如银行或政府,而区块链通过网络中的所有节点共同维护数据,消除了对单个管理者的依赖。这不仅提高了系统的鲁棒性,也减少了权力的不对等。
去中心化的另一个重要方面是成本控制。通过消除中心化的管理和处理机构,参与者可以减少中介费用。此外,去中心化还使得系统不容易受到恶意攻击,因为攻击者需要同时控制网络中大部分的节点才能对数据进行篡改。而在分布式网络中,这样的攻击成本极高。因此,去中心化自然增强了系统的安全性。
加密技术是区块链确保数据安全的重要手段。在区块链中,数据以加密格式储存,确保只有持有正确私钥的用户才能访问和操作对应数据。同时,每个区块都会包含其前一个区块的哈希值,这确保了区块链的不可篡改性,因为如果尝试更改任意一个块,都会导致其后的所有块的哈希值失效,从而被网络轻易识别。
此外,区块链使用公钥和私钥的机制来保证交易的安全性。用户通过私钥对交易进行签名,而其他用户则使用公钥验证这一签名。只有签名有效的交易才能被网络记录,这种方式极大保护了用户的资产安全和隐私。
共识机制是区块链网络中各个节点就交易有效性达成一致的方式。不同的区块链网络采用了不同的共识机制,例如比特币使用的工作量证明(Pow)以及以太坊计划转向的权益证明(PoS)。这些机制不仅确保了数据的有效性,还能防止双重支付等问题。
工作量证明要求参与者解决复杂的数学问题以获得矿工奖励,这种机制确保了网络的安全,但也导致了较大的能源消耗。而权益证明则是将区块的生成权基于用户持有的币量和时间,减少了对计算能力的要求,提升了能效。每种共识机制都有其优劣之处,如何权衡这些因素一直是区块链技术发展的研究热点。
智能合约是一种自执行的合约,协议条款直接写入代码中,并在区块链上运行。这一概念由以太坊首创,利用了其区块链平台的智能合约功能。智能合约可以自动执行、控制和记录事件和行动,省去了人工干预及中介的需要,从而减少了时间和成本。
智能合约的应用场景非常广泛。例如,房地产交易中,可以通过智能合约自动完成买卖双方的资金、物业的转移,而不需要人工处理,从而提升了交易的效率。此外,还可以用于供应链管理,通过追踪产品的流通情况、自动执行支付等环节来提高透明度,降低欺诈风险。
区块链技术在实际应用中已经展现了巨大的潜力,尤其是在金融服务、身份认证、物流管理和医疗健康等领域。具体来说:
在金融服务中,区块链能够缩短交易时间,降低跨境支付的费用,同时提高透明度。例如,使用区块链进行跨国汇款,传统银行可能需要几天,而通过使用区块链,可以在几分钟之内完成。
在身份认证方面,区块链可以提供一种去中心化的身份管理方式,用户可以控制自己的身份数据,防止个人信息泄露与滥用。
物流管理方面,区块链可以实时跟踪产品在供应链中的位置以及状态,参与者可以通过区块链实时获取货物运输信息,提高效率,降低延误风险。
在医疗健康领域,区块链可以安全地存储和分享患者的健康记录,从而确保患者能够在不同医疗机构之间顺利转换,提高医疗服务质量。
区块链的引入为许多传统行业带来了创新机遇。对于金融行业而言,区块链技术的去中心化特点促使许多新型的金融科技公司应运而生,例如去中心化金融(DeFi)平台。这些平台通过区块链技术提供贷款、交易和保险等服务,挑战了传统金融机构的垄断地位。
在供应链管理方面,区块链能够提高透明度和可追溯性。通过实时记录每一环节的数据,企业能够追踪产品从厂家到消费者的全过程,有助于防止假冒伪劣商品的出现,提升消费者信任。
不同行业的转型也催生了新的商业模式。比如在艺术品交易中,通过区块链技术,可以实现艺术品的数字化和商品化,给艺术家带来更多收入的同时,也为收藏者提供了更便利的交易途径。
尽管区块链技术前景广阔,但仍面临一些技术挑战。首先是可扩展性问题,特别是在高交易量的场景下,像比特币这样的公链在性能上无法满足快速交易的需求,导致交易延迟与费用增加。针对这一问题,多层解决方案或者侧链技术应运而生,致力于提高网络的处理能力。
另一个挑战是隐私问题。在许多区块链上,所有交易都是公开的,这使得用户的隐私难以得到充分保护。为解决这个问题,许多研究者正在探讨零知识证明和隐私币等技术,以保障用户在区块链上的匿名性与安全性。
此外,合规性也是一个不可忽视的问题。随着各国政府对加密资产监管力度加大,区块链项目需在合规的框架下运营,以确保法律的合规性。
展望未来,区块链技术的发展趋势将集中在几个方面。首先,随着越来越多的行业探索区块链应用,跨链技术将越来越受到关注。跨链能够链接不同公链,允许资产在不同链之间转移,促进了资源的高效利用。
其次,结合人工智能与区块链的研究也将逐渐升温。通过结合两者的优势,能够实现自动化的决策与数据分析,提高区块链应用的智能性和实时性。
随着人们对隐私保护意识的提高,区块链隐私保护技术的发展也将成为一大趋势。未来的区块链可能会在保护用户数据隐私的同时,保持效率与安全。
最后,随着政府、学术界和企业对区块链的深入研究,综合标准和协议的制定将推动行业的发展,使区块链在各个领域的应用更加普及。
总的来说,区块链技术的工作原理复杂而又精妙,未来的发展潜力无限。通过合理利用这项技术,我们将能够建设出一个更加透明、安全与高效的社会。